GoBD-Verstöße und Betriebsprüfungs-Risiken durch mangelhafte digitale Liefernachweise
Definition
German tax authorities under BMF (Bundesfinanzministerium) guidance now audit digital compliance during Betriebsprüfung. GoBD § 1 Abs. 1 mandates that all business records must be documented, complete, timely, orderly, and verifiable. Delivery confirmations—especially those involving third-party carriers—must include: date/time, sender, recipient, goods detail, signature/authentication, and archival location. The search result on § 17a UStDV explicitly states that electronic tracking logs require 'complete evidence of the transport route' to substitute for physical signatures. Printing companies relying on email confirmations, unsigned carrier receipts, or fax-only documentation face audit findings. IDW (Institut der Wirtschaftsprüfer) audits in Germany have increasingly cited delivery documentation deficiencies as major audit findings. Penalties under § 90 Abs. 3 AO (Tax Code) range from €5,000 minimum (minor omissions) to €50,000+ for systematic non-compliance.
